Access significant capital without liquidating your client’s portfolio. Our relationship managers can provide a range of lending options for clients with execution-only portfolios held via our custody & dealing platform. They can also lend over discretionary and advisory-based investment portfolios held with Investec Wealth & Investment (CI), now part of the Rathbones Group.
Borrowing against existing stocks and shares lets your clients release equity to fund new opportunities. You choose when and how you repay the loan, and you have the option to repay interest from your client’s Investec portfolio’s income.
Our portfolio loans offer a fast, flexible and cost-efficient way to borrow against investments. Your clients receive indicative feedback on the loan application in days not weeks. They can borrow in sterling, US dollars or euros.
How portfolio lending works
When your clients take out a portfolio loan with us, we are required to act as the custodian of the portfolio used to raise funds. We provide a loan to value based on the portfolio’s level of risk, taking into account the types of investments and diversification.
